RUNWAYS

Runway detail & declared distances

1 runway · longest 2,500 ft

07/25
Dimensions
2,500 x 100 ft
Surface
Dirt
RWY 07
RWY 25

AIRPORT REMARKS

Operational remarks

FOR CD CTC BIG SKY APCH AT 208-364-5860/5861.
PRVDD POWER LINE IS OBSTRUCTION LIGHTED AND/OR MARKED; SIGNS WARNING MOTORIST OF LOW FLYING ACFT.
